| Metric | Point Park University Pittsburgh, PA | Vet Tech Institute Pittsburgh, PA |
|---|---|---|
| Location | Pittsburgh, PA | Pittsburgh, PA |
| Type | Private Nonprofit | Private For-Profit |
| Total Enrollment | 2,331 | 183 |
| Acceptance Rate | 96.9% | 77.5% |
| SAT Average | — | — |
| In-State Tuition | $39,570 | $17,320 |
| Out-of-State Tuition | $39,570 | $17,320 |
| Avg Net Price | $25,942 | $16,531 |
| Median Debt at Graduation | $27,000 | $13,623 |
| 4-Year Graduation Rate | 59.1% | — |
| Retention Rate | 73.9% | — |
| Median Earnings (6 yr) | $36,906 | $33,750 |
| Median Earnings (10 yr) | $45,856 | $34,583 |

Frequently Asked Questions
How do Point Park University and Vet Tech Institute compare?▼
Point Park University (Pittsburgh, PA) has an acceptance rate of 96.9%, in-state tuition of $39,570, and median 10-year earnings of $45,856. Vet Tech Institute (Pittsburgh, PA) has an acceptance rate of 77.5%, in-state tuition of $17,320, and median 10-year earnings of $34,583.
Which school has higher graduate earnings, Point Park University or Vet Tech Institute?▼
Point Park University graduates earn more at 10 years out, with a median of $45,856 vs $34,583. Source: U.S. Department of Education College Scorecard.
Which school is more affordable, Point Park University or Vet Tech Institute?▼
Based on average net price (after grants and scholarships), Vet Tech Institute is the more affordable option at $16,531 per year versus $25,942.
